Precautions on cruise control

-If the cruise control system malfunctions, it cancels automatically.

WARNING:

Do not use the cruise control when driving under the following conditions:

- When it is not possible to keep the vehicle at a set speed.

- In heavy traffic or in traffic that varies in speed.

- On winding or hilly roads.

- On slippery roads (rain, snow, ice, etc.).

- In very windy areas.

Doing so could cause a loss of vehicle control and result in an accident.
